Annie Londonderry, a woman of audacity and charisma, accepted a wager to cycle around the world in the late 1800s, a time when bicycles were deemed dangerous for women. Her journey, filled with exaggerated tales, became legendary. However, her great-grandnephew, Peter Zeitlin, reveals that many of her stories were fabricated. Despite the myths, Annie's true achievement was her role as a symbol of the women's liberation movement, showcasing her determination and independence in a male-dominated society.
